The Mandela Result is a phenomenon that refers to a cumulative misremembering of a truth or occasion. It is named after Nelson Mandela, the previous President of South Africa, who many individuals thought had passed away in prison in the 1980s. Nevertheless, Mandela was actually released from jail in 1990 and went on to end up being the President of South Africa. The term "Mandela Impact" was created by paranormal scientist Fiona Broome in 2010, after she found that many people shared the same false memory of Mandela's death.

Examples of the Mandela Result
There are many examples of the Mandela Impact that have gained extensive attention. One of the most widely known examples is the case of the Berenstain Bears. Lots of people remember the popular kids's book series as being spelled "Berenstein Bears," with an "e" rather of an "a." However, all evidence shows that the appropriate spelling is "Berenstain Bears."

The Science Behind the Mandela Effect.
To comprehend the Mandela Impact, it is important to understand how memory works. Memory is not an ideal recording of occasions, however rather a restoration based upon our understandings and experiences. Our memories can be influenced by a variety of elements, including suggestion, social impact, and individual biases.
Recommendation plays a substantial function in forming our memories. When we are exposed to details that contradicts our existing beliefs or memories, we might be more likely to embrace the new information as true. This can result in the development of false memories or the modification of existing memories.

Theories on Parallel Universes
The concept of parallel universes has been checked out in various clinical theories and works of fiction. In essence, parallel universes are believed to be different truths that exist together with our own, each with its own set of physical laws and outcomes.
One theory on parallel universes is known as the "Many-Worlds Analysis" of quantum mechanics. According to this theory, every possible result of an event really occurs in a separate universe. For instance, if you were to flip a coin, there would be one universe where it arrive at heads and another where it arrive on tails.
Another theory is the "Brane Theory," which suggests that our universe is simply one of lots of "branes" or membranes that exist in a higher-dimensional area. These branes can collide or connect with each other, potentially resulting in the production of parallel universes.
